This hydraulic clutch release bearing (model F2T7A564A/510004610) is designed specifically for Ford vehicles. It integrates a hydraulic drive system with precision mechanical structure to achieve efficient clutch disengagement and engagement. Its core components are die-cast from high-strength aluminum alloy and feature a self-aligning bearing structure, effectively balancing axial and radial loads and reducing wear caused by offset loading. Optimized hydraulic oil channel design and high-temperature-resistant sealing materials ensure stable hydraulic transmission efficiency even under high-load conditions. A heat dissipation structure reduces operating temperatures and extends the life of critical components.
As a key component in automotive transmission systems, this release bearing strictly adheres to ISO 9001 and TS 16949 quality management system standards, undergoing multiple precision inspection processes from raw material selection to finished product testing. Its structural design is compatible with the clutch systems of various Ford models, including the Ranger, F-150, and F-250. The synergistic action of the preload spring and diaphragm spring ensures smooth disengagement and precise return control. The product adopts a modular manufacturing process, which reduces the complex installation steps of traditional mechanical release bearings. At the same time, it improves wear resistance through surface hardening treatment, making it suitable for heavy-load conditions with frequent gear shifting.
